The size of Redlynch is approximately 25.4 square kilometres. It has 23 parks covering nearly 3.6% of total area. The population of Redlynch in 2016 was 9728 people. By 2021 the population was 10571 showing a population growth of 8.7%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Redlynch is 10-19 years. Households in Redlynch are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Redlynch work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 76.60% of the homes in Redlynch were owner-occupied compared with 71.60% in 2016.
